The Sturm Group in Salching, Bavaria, has approximately 500 employees spread across eight national and international locations. The specialist in automation, conveyor and surface technology has continuously strengthened its occupational safety measures in recent years. The need for this was also recognised in the area of "manual cutting", as there were more than ten serious cutting injuries in logistics alone in 2018.
solution
The southern German company has been working with MARTOR safety knives since 2019 to optimise the occupational safety of its employees in this area as well. With success: by 2020, the number of cuts had already been reduced to zero, making painful and costly sick days a thing of the past.
For the cutting applications prevalent in the Sturm Group (cardboard, film, plastic strapping band), the SECUMAX 350 and SECUNORM 540 safety knives have been used since then, as well as the SECUNORM 380, especially in the assembly area.
